Public Unveiling: Weaving Story into Movement

Saturday, April 4, 2026 (10 am) | FREE La'akea Village (639 Baldwin Ave, Paia, HI 96779)

 

Join us for the public unveiling of a contemporary dance commission by choreographer Karli Jo List. Centered on a Hui Moʻolelo recording featuring Hawaiian scholar Pūlama Collier and her son, Kiaʻi Collier, this project explores themes of guardianship, "cherishing," and the deep-rooted responsibility of land stewardship.

 

Guided by place-based narrative, public activities and community consultations, this commission embodies public art as a shared practice. As Pūlama shares, “Once you hear the story, then it becomes your story too.” We invite the community to join us in celebrating this triangulation of movement, landscape, and ancestral narrative.
